Formula

Stringer Length = √(Total Rise² + Total Run²) | Risers = Total Rise / Riser Height | Treads = Risers - 1

What is the building code for stair dimensions?
Per the IRC (International Residential Code): maximum riser height is 7.75 inches, minimum tread depth is 10 inches, minimum stair width is 36 inches, and minimum headroom is 6 feet 8 inches. The rise+run sum should be between 17 and 18 inches for comfortable stairs.
How do I cut stair stringers?
Mark the rise and run on a framing square, then transfer these marks along the 2×12 board. Cut the notches with a circular saw and finish corners with a handsaw. The bottom riser must be reduced by the tread thickness (typically 1 inch for decking). Always maintain at least 3.5 inches of throat thickness.
